Ar Iau, 2006-09-28 am 07:45 -0700, ysgrifennodd Linus Torvalds:
> I have been told that legally, "putting something in the public domain"
> isn't actually really possible in the US, but maybe that is something that
> lawyers disagree about.

Its also a very bad idea for another reason. In some parts of the world
placing something in the public domain doesn't imply any kind of
warranty or liability disclaimer.
